I liked: clean room clean sheets warm welcome nice food free internet I didn't like: room overpriced (400€/night) food extremely overpriced (breakfast buffet = 25€) Considering the other hotels in Lagos, I will definitley return to this hotel More

Hotel quality was fine, but be careful of the hidden charges. We were charged an extra night because we checked in before 2pm!!! Even the duty manager refused to compromise.
